Ten-Inch Ovechkin Coming To A Retailer Near You

You might recall last year that Upper Deck released a limited number of Alex Ovechkin action figures as part of their All-Star Vinyl line. Now comes word via Beckett Behind The Scenes that the line (including a new Ovechkin figure) "soon will expand into a larger series of 10-inch figures available at retail stores."

This is good news for collectors and anyone who would want one of these (for their kid, of course):

Make sure to check out the whole set of figures (the Roberto Luongo one is particularly frightening).

Evgeny Kuznetsov hams it up as he joins the Russia men's national team for the "Sweden Games" leg of the Euro Hockey Tour in Helsinki, Finland.

There's a bit of controversy as their game against the Finns is scheduled to be played in Helsinki's outdoor Olympic Stadium.   Where the daytime temps are currently approximately minus-15 degrees Celsius, with periodic heavy snow.

This interview with head coach Zinetula Bilyaletdinov is fascinating, as he frets about the weather and especially when the reporters press him on the leaked reports that Kuznetsov will be centering the top line for Team Russia, just weeks after his 20th birthday.
